GRILLED NEW YORK STRIP STEAK WITH PAN ROASTED FIGS AND SHALLOTS

Prep Time: 30 Min.
Cook Time: 30 Min.
Yield: 2 servings
Ingredients
- 2 New York Strip Steak
- Salt & Pepper
- 2 oz. Goat Cheese, garlic & herb
- 3 tbsp. Extra Virgin Olive Oils
- 6 Shallots, peeled & quartered
- 10 to 12 Black Olives, pitted
- 6 oz. Balsamic Vinegar
- 1 sprig thyme
- 4 Figs, quartered
- 1/2 stick Salted Butter
- 3 tbsp. Parsley, chopped
Directions

- Season steak with salt and pepper, grill to your liking, hold aside.
- In a sauté pan over medium-high heat, sweat the shallots and olives in olive oil until translucent.
- Add a sprig of fresh thyme and deglaze the pan with balsamic vinegar.
- Add figs and butter, swirling them around until the butter melts, add parsley.
- Place your steaks on a serving platter and smear 1 ounce of goat cheese on each steak.
- Spoon fig and shallot mixture over each steak and serve.
